Runbook: upgrading the Tollwick broker. Drain consumers first, then upgrade one node at a time, oldest first. Wait for replication to settle between nodes — do not rush this. If a node refuses to rejoin, check its log offset before restarting. Rollback is only safe before the second node upgrades. Each node starts with the following configuration values.

settings of tagef-bawif:
DRUIX_HOST=druix.zemvarlabs.internal
DRUIX_PORT=8000

Checkout load tests on Fennelcart run nightly against the Brume staging ring. Artifacts from the load harness must be signed before upload, or the gate rejects them. Build with `make loadpack`, verify the digest matches the run manifest, then sign. No unsigned artifacts, ever, even for throwaway runs. The current signing key for the harness is listed here.

signing key of fahof-tahof = bky13_rpcUNgEnLB4i2

## Releases

Hey support folks — quick notes on ProfileMesh shard releases. Each release re-balances user-profile shards gradually, so don't panic if a lookup lands on a stale shard for a few minutes post-deploy; it self-heals. Release bundles are published twice a month and are always signed. If a customer asks you to verify a bundle they downloaded, walk them through the checksum step using the public signing key below.

deploy key for kawif-bageg: bky19_YQNdHDgpaLxUNwPoHm9

Ticket: FIELD-2281 — Expired credentials blocking offline sync

For the weekly sync: the Heronpath field-survey app's offline mode stopped reconciling on Monday because the cached sync token expired while crews were out of coverage. Surveys queued locally are intact, but uploads fail silently until re-auth. We've extended token lifetime to 30 days and reissued credentials. The replacement key for the internal sync service follows.

service key, fafog-fahaf: vxb3-x55

## Sensor drift: what to do at 3am

If the GrowLoop controller starts reporting humidity swings that don't match the backup probes in the Fernwick greenhouse, it's almost always sensor drift, not an actual climate event. Don't panic and don't touch the vents manually. First, restart the calibration daemon and give it ten minutes to re-baseline. If readings still disagree by more than 5%, flip the controller into safe mode. The safe-mode thresholds it will use are these.

config for yahap-bajof:
[istix]
host = istix.qorvelsys.internal
user = istix_svc
database = istix_prod